cage looks really good!did you have to drop it through the floor to get it that low to get at the roll over hoop welds? excellent work![]()

yeah its a custom cages, and yes made the roof plate myself, hate plates riveted on look tatty. yeah cut holes in the floor and ratchet strap around legs and drop it though. really easy.

some more pics of the cage finished. just a few gussets to fit but thats all the tube installed, will be finishing the seam welding in the car and the seat rails this week. then will be time to flip the car over to finish the under side of the shell.
